Поделиться через


Элемент ParameterBinding (List)

Применимо к: SharePoint 2016 | SharePoint Foundation 2013 | SharePoint Online | SharePoint Server 2013

Задает привязку параметров таблицы стилей, чтобы сделать ресурс доступным для XSL, который отрисовывает представление.

<ParameterBinding  Name = "Text"  Location = "Text" />

Элементы и атрибуты

В разделах ниже приводится описание атрибутов, дочерних и родительских элементов.

Атрибуты

Атрибут Описание
Name
Необязательный текст. Указывает имя параметра. Таблица стилей XSL определяет параметр с тем же именем <xsl:param name="ParameterName"/> , и ресурс становится доступным в любом месте таблицы стилей с помощью выражения <xsl:value-of select="$ParameterName" />XPath .
Location
Необязательный текст. Указывает расположение ресурса. SharePoint Foundation использует функцию Resource для определения значения Location в формате Location = "Resource(ResourceFile, ResourceName)", где ResourceFile указывает базовое имя файла ресурсов без расширения файла, а ResourceName — имя строки ресурса.

Помимо указания локализованного ресурса в RESX-файле, атрибут Location можно использовать для указания значений, указанных в следующей таблице.

Значения атрибутов location

Context Format
Строки запроса
<ParameterBinding Name="SelectedID" Location="QueryString(SelectedID)"/>Соответствующий код в XSL: <xsl:param name="SelectedID"/>
Подключение и обратная связь
<ParameterBinding Name="dvt_firstrow" Location="Postback;Connection"/>
Серверные переменные
(Location="Form(variableName)")
Свойства веб-части
(Location="WPProperty(PropertyValue")
Идентификаторы элементов управления
(Location="Control(ControlID)")

Дочерние элементы

Нет

Родительские элементы

Occurrences

  • Минимум: 0
  • Максимум: без ограничений

См. также